Arts Center hosting Artist Studio Tour Saturday, Sept. 26
The Crooked Tree Arts Center will present an Artist Studio Tour on Saturday, September 26, from 10:00 a.m. to 4:00 p.m. The tour is self guided and each artist will be in their studios to share their inspirations, techniques, and methods.

Cross Village native among 'The Polar Bears' who fought for eight months in Russia inWWI
In September 1918, though told they were headed to France, the soldiers in company M 339th Infantry were shipped from Camp Custer in Battle Creek, Michigan, to the bitter cold Archangel, Russia.
